ABSTRACT OBJECTIVES: Ceruloplasmin (Cp) and non-ceruloplasmin-bound copper (NCC) are measured when evaluating liver disease and disorders of copper (Cu) metabolism. Cp mass concentration is typically determined by immunoassays that detect both apo- and holoceruloplasmin. In contrast, enzymatic assays measure Cp ferroxidase activity … Read more
